Remember wishing that you could fly when you were a child? Just take off and fly among the clouds - leaning into the wind and having it lift you up for a wonderful ride - wouldn't that be fun! Flying has held man's attention for thousands of years, and still captures the attention of kids of all ages. This four-week unit study takes your student along a learning path that covers the history and science of flight, while introducing them to famous flyers, inventors and other brave aviation adventurers. Come join us on this new adventure, and see what in the world has been happening in flight since before Leonardo da Vinci first began sketching his ideas for a flying machine! Did you know that Marco Polo witnessed kites carrying humans in China? And don't tell the kids, but in 1010, a Benedictine monk was the first man to fly for some distance with the aid of wings - before falling and breaking his legs. In addition to the history, we will delve into the science of flight - what makes an airplane fly, how is it controlled, and so much more. The Flight Unit study contains 20 days of lesson plans for two levels, Lower Level (elementary) and Upper Level (Jr/Sr High). The study also includes many online resources, book suggestions, project ideas, and much more. A fascinating learning adventure for everyone!
